Evron Dansie Lemmon, age 100 of Rigby passed away Wednesday, February 27, 2008 at the Rexburg Nursing and Rehabilitation Center. She was born September 23, 1907 in Draper, Utah. Her Father was Charles Nephi Dansie and her Mother was Mary Amy Fitzgerald Dansie. Evron attended Rigby schools and graduated from Rigby High School with the class of 1925. She went to Link Business College in Idaho Falls, and went to work at the Rigby Court House doing typing for the County Auditor and Records Department. She later worked for her brother, Jerry at the Dansie Jewelry store on Main Street in Rigby. In 1956, she started working for the Idaho 1st National Bank and retired from there after 16 years of service. She also worked at the County and City Election Polls for many years. She was married to Pete Lott and then to Louis Wilcox. Divorces ended these marriages. In January 1963 she married Oliver Lemmon. He died in 1974. She was an active member of the LDS Church and held several positions during her life time. She loved her family and enjoyed doing little acts of kindness for them. She is survived by two sons, LaMar (Mary Ann) Wilcox of League City, Texas and Chuck (Barbara) Wilcox of Rigby, two step-daughters, Vila Hawkins of Rigby and Gaye Johnson of Idaho Falls, fifteen grandchildren, fifty-three great-grandchildren, and nineteen great-great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her Husband, Oliver Lemmon, daughter, Jean Arnold, her parents, Nephi and Amy Dansie, her two sisters, Lova Kinghorn and Barbara Jardine, her two brothers, Ronald and Jerry Dansie and a grandson, Perry Hawkins.
